But it does pay the bills. So this makes me wonder why they do not create Warcraft 4 and let it exist together with WoW. As we all know World of Warcraft is in decline. Not dying, just in decline. And as such, it would be smart for Blizzard to make plans as to what will happen in the event of WoW not being profitable anymore.
They could begin development on Warcraft 4 and place it many, many years in the future, or alternatively many, many years in the past. It would have no effect on the current WoW universe and they would still have room to create whatever lore they wanted for the current WoW without worry. If set in the past, it could be in the time before Sargeras turned evil, back in the days when the Titans fought the Old Gods or even prior to that. If set in the future, it could be comprised of completely new characters, characters that merely have mild connections to the Azeroth of the present.
*This would be highly beneficial in three ways:
1.) The complete and utter fan craze and hype around Warcraft 4 would renew interest in WoW and easily boost subscriptions by millions. Just take a look at the hype around Diablo and Starcraft. People would go ape-shit for Warcraft 4.
2.) It would give them a basis for WoW 2. If they decide to scrap the current WoW at any point in the future, they would have existing and compelling lore for a WoW 2 and would not have to wait additional years just to release a few Warcrafts.
3.) Warcraft fans are growing up. And as such, many of us are more attracted to darker storylines. Something gritty and compelling, not something PG. WoW is too mainstream for Blizzard to truly make it as dark as the Warcraft RTS games, but a new RTS could be as gritty as they please.
In summary, Warcraft lore and community has suffered greatly from the popularity of WoW. However, all is not lost and Warcraft can once again climb to the heights of Blizzard games such as Diablo. But for that to happen Warcraft fans need a real Warcraft game, something they can bite into. Blizzard should start development on Warcraft 4, either set in the past or far in the future so as not to interfere with the cash-cow, WoW.
